Transaction bf76a46dae63f6d121d42be3de8d58f2da3b9a37f29e004756b698d01f6c90ac
1 Input
2 Outputs
- bf76a46dae63f6d121d42be3de8d58f2da3b9a37f29e004756b698d01f6c90ac:0
- bf76a46dae63f6d121d42be3de8d58f2da3b9a37f29e004756b698d01f6c90ac:1
value 158910929
address 15RuEmpgf7vE2uYNEenQEKYD1ccqKMzVZc
value 1354127
address 3K331fa1fe1Kb5rWYrru3f3TUQW6e1bb4h